Question 72 Marks
State the correspondence between the vertices, sides and angles of the following pairs of congruent triangles. $\triangle\text{CAB}\cong\triangle\text{QRP}$
Answer
$\triangle\text{CAB}\cong\triangle\text{QRP},$
$\text{C}\leftrightarrow\text{Q},\text{A}\leftrightarrow\text{R}$ and $\text{B}\leftrightarrow\text{P}$
$\text{CA}=\text{QR},\text{AB}=\text{RP}$ and$\text{ BC}=\text{ PQ}$
$\angle\text{C}=\angle\text{Q},\angle\text{A}=\angle\text{R}$ and $\angle\text{B}=\angle\text{P}$

Question 82 Marks
State the correspondence between the vertices, sides and angles of the following pairs of congruent triangles. $\triangle\text{XZY}\cong\triangle\text{QPR}$
Answer
$\triangle\text{XZY}\cong\triangle\text{QPR},$
Then $\text{X}\leftrightarrow\text{Q},\text{Z}\leftrightarrow\text{P}$ and $\text{Y}\leftrightarrow\text{R}$
$\text{XZ}=\text{QP},\text{ZY}=\text{PR}$ and $\text{ YX}=\text{ RQ}$
$\angle\text{X}=\angle\text{Q},\angle\text{Z}=\angle\text{P}$ and $\angle\text{Y}=\angle\text{R}$

Question 92 Marks
State the correspondence between the vertices, sides and angles of the following pairs of congruent triangles. $\triangle\text{MPN}\cong\triangle\text{SQR}$
Answer
$\triangle\text{MPN}\cong\triangle\text{SQR},$
Then $\text{M}\leftrightarrow\text{S},\text{P}\leftrightarrow\text{Q}$ and $\text{N}\leftrightarrow\text{R}$
$\text{MP}=\text{SQ},\text{PN}=\text{QR}$ and $\text{ NM}=\text{ RS}$
$\angle\text{M}=\angle\text{S},\angle\text{P}=\angle\text{Q}$ and $\angle\text{N}=\angle\text{R}$
